About Electric Immersion Water Heater?
An electric immersion heater is a device that warms water by directly putting a heating element into the water. The element is electrically charged and rapidly warms the water. These heaters are broadly utilized in different applications, including home water heating, industrial tanks, and chemical processing systems also.
Not at all like other types of heaters that warm the water through convection or radiation, Immersion heaters convey direct warming, making them profoundly proficient. This is one of the reasons they are a favored choice in both industrial and residential areas.
Types of Immersion Heaters
Before going deep into the process of choosing the right heater, it's essential to know about the various types of immersion heaters available:
1. Flanged Immersion Heaters: These are great for large industrial tanks and vessels. They are dashed onto the side of the tank, and the warming components are inserted directly into the water.
2. Screw Plug Immersion Heaters: These are generally utilized in smaller applications, like home water heaters. They screw straightforwardly into a threaded opening in the tank and heat water proficiently.
3. Over-the-Side Immersion Heaters: Their direct establishment inside the tank is troublesome. The heater is put over the side of the tank, with the heating elements lowered in the fluid.
4. Circulation Heaters: These are utilized for heating fluids in a closed-loop system. They are great for industrial processes where keeping a particular water temperature is basic.
Factors to Consider When Choosing an Electric Immersion Water Heater
Here are some important factors to keep in mind while selecting the right electric immersion heater for your application:
1. Application
The type of application you are using the heater for will decide the right model for you. For example, if you really want a heater for industrial processing or large tanks, you might need to decide on a flanged immersion heater because of its high effectiveness and power. Then again, for residential use or small commercial applications, screw plug heaters are many times a superior fit.
2. Material Compatability
Electric immersion water heaters come in different materials, including treated steel, titanium, and copper. It's fundamental to pick a material viable with the fluid you are heating.
• Stainless steel is ordinarily utilized for water heating since it opposes consumption.
• Titanium is exceptionally resistant to corrosion and is great for chemically aggressive or destructive fluids.
• Copper offers excellent heat conductivity and is oftentimes utilized in residential water heaters.

3. Power Requirements
The power rating of an electric immersion water heater is another basic component. This is typically estimated in kilowatts (kW) and decides how rapidly the heater can carry water to the ideal temperature. The higher the wattage, the quicker the heating process. For example:
• Lower wattage heaters (1-3 kW) are reasonable for residential water heating applications.
• Higher wattage heaters (5-20 kW) are much of the time utilized in industrial applications where large volumes of water should be warmed rapidly.

4. Temperature Control
For industrial applications or processes that require exact temperature control, picking a heater with an integrated thermostat is significant. Many electric immersion water heaters offer advanced or mechanical temperature controls, which permit you to set the ideal temperature and keep up with it reliably.

5. Safety Features
Security should be a main concern when picking an electric immersion heater. Elements like thermal cut-off switches, overheat protection, and pressure relief valves are fundamental to prevent accidents and increase the life of your heaters. Make sure the heater will follow the industry safety standards and certifications.
